For GSS, you have flat numbers for your stats instead of modifiers, which are compared against other peoples' numbers to determine success. Dreams let you increase your relationship numbers, and your relationships to and from other people give you bonus points that you can spend to temporarily increase your stat numbers for one comparison.
 
cost to strengthen connectionTo Costs
1: 5 Dreams (0 with Impression Check)
2: 5 Dreams (0 with Impression Check)
3: 5 Dreams
4: 8 Dreams
5:12 Dreams
the first two points don't technically need dreams
but yeah beyond that point
and I guess maybe the checks can only be made when characters first meet
so after that point you definitely need dreams for it
